Known around the world as the driving force behind Liverpool indie trailblazers The Pale Fountains and Shack, singer-songwriter Michael Head brings his group The Red Elastic Band to Brewery Arts to play tracks from their stomping new LP ‘Loophole’, plus some familiar favourites.

62 years of music, loves, losses, long summer days and longer, darker nights are vividly recalled by ‘our greatest living songwriter’, Michael Head and The Red Elastic Band as he plays out flickering scenes from his life on new album, Loophole.

Matching happiness with creativity and hitching his faith in love to a new era of productivity, Head will release his second solo album with The Red Elastic Band less than two years after 2022’s remarkable, universally acclaimed Dear Scott. Thanks, in part, to the memory-jolting joy and frequent shocks found in the process of writing his memoirs, Head wrote and recorded at career-record-breaking pace, finding that those places, faces and voices from the past have all rushed to take their place amongst the 12 new songs heard across Loophole.

Following up December’s standalone single, ‘Ciao Ciao Bambino’, Head now sets the countdown to Loophole’s release, running with new single, ‘Shirl’s Ghost’.

With no shortage of fervour amongst his long-term listeners and those discovering him anew following Dear Scott’s success, fans have the chance of gathering to hear many of the songs that sang their lives.
